# Settings for the Driftwell documentation linter.
# Welcome aboard — this file controls which style rules run against
# the Harborline docs repo. Rule severities are set per-directory;
# don't loosen anything under /guides without sign-off from the docs lead.
# The linter caches terminology lookups in a small Postgres instance
# so repeat runs stay fast. It reads its cache database from the
# connection string directly below this comment.

primary connection of yagep-kahip = redis://giliel_svc:zYiKsLL2PLpfPL@db-348f.xolmarsys.corp:5432/fenwyn

## Deploying the Gatewick Proctor Queue

Deploys are pretty painless: push to main, wait for the pipeline, then watch the queue drain dashboard for five minutes. If candidates pile up mid-exam, roll back first and ask questions later — the queue replays safely. Everything the workers care about lives in one config block, shown here for reference.

settings of bafof-yagef:
JOROX_PIN=8740
JOROX_TENANT=pelox
JOROX_METRICS_HOST=metrics.jorox.qorvelworks.internal
JOROX_SEAL=seal_c78f63c1
JOROX_STANDBY_TEAM=norax

### Step 4: Encoding detection

Quick heads-up before you touch the upload path: Fernwheel used to assume everything was UTF-8, which broke badly for files from older desktop exports. The new detector sniffs the first 8KB and falls back to a configurable default instead of erroring out. You'll need to flip the detection mode on in staging before running the backfill script. Once you've done that, confirm your service is running with these settings.

service settings:
[norax]
team = zormir
access_code = ac_c302d9
owner = ralmir.zorox
host = norax.zarqeltech.internal
port = 11211
peer = praion.halixlabs.example
salt = 9c2a54f3
pin = 9824

**14:22** — Sensor drift confirmed on GrowMaster bay 3 humidity probes. Root cause: calibration table stale after the Pellbrook firmware rollout; controller compensated incorrectly, pushing vents open overnight. Mitigation: reverted calibration table, re-flashed probes, verified readings within tolerance by 15:40. Follow-up: add calibration checksum to the deploy gate. The rollback build is pinned, and its trace token is recorded below for the sync notes.

session token of tadug-bagep = htk9_7d92de289